Job Title: Secretary                                                         Job Code: 305, 487 or 420

 

Department/Location: Varies                                          FLSA Status: Non-Exempt

 

Reports to: Assigned Supervisor                                             Date: October 11, 2005

                   

 

Summary and relationship to the curriculum: All classified positions will strengthen the delivery of instruction to support the system’s mission. This position provides administrative secretarial support.

 

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

 

  1. Interacts effectively with the general public, staff members, students, teachers, parents, and administrators, using tact and good judgment.

 

  1. Performs a variety of duties to support supervisory and administrative personnel in accomplishing daily activities.

 

  1. Composes, creates, edits or transcribes correspondence, e-mails, newsletters, memorandums, and other materials.

 

  1. Maintains files, accurate records, and other important information associated with the position.

 

  1. Answers telephones, responds to inquiries, takes messages, or transfers calls appropriately. Greets visitors, ascertains nature of business and directs visitors appropriately.

 

  1. Assists in maintaining efficient office operations by providing secretarial relief whenever and wherever needed.

 

  1. Operates various equipment associated with the department, such as computer, fax machine, copier, as well as equipment developed or advanced from future technology as required by the job.

 

  1. Prepares reports and manages specific programs associated with the position as required.

 

  1. Maintains department schedule by maintaining calendars for department personnel; arranges meetings, conferences, and trips for administrators and staff.

 

  1. Prepares documents and packages for mailing, receives, stamps, and distributes mail to appropriate personnel.

 

  1. Prepares purchase orders for materials, resources, and office supplies; monitors expenses.

 

  1. Performs other duties as assigned the department head or appropriate supervisor.

 

 

Qualifications: To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ily.  The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required.  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. 

 

a) Education and/or Experience: High school diploma or general education degree   (GED) required, associate degree or technical school training preferred.

 

b) Certificate or License Required:        N/A

 

c) Language Skills: Ability to read and comprehend simple instructions, short correspondence, and memos.  Ability to write simple correspondence.  Ability to effectively present information in one-on-one and small-group situations.      

 

d) Mathematical Skills: Ability to add, subtract, multiply and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als.  Ability to compute rate, ratio, and percent and to create graphs.

 

e) Reasoning Ability: Ability to apply commonsense understanding to carry out detailed but uninvolved written or oral instructions. Ability to deal with problems involving a few concrete variables in standardized situations.

 

f) Technical Ability: Must have considerable knowledge of Microsoft Office Products 

 

g) Customer Service Skills:  Must be capable of interacting effectively with administrators, teachers, staff members, students, parents, and the general public using tactful and helpful customer service.

                                                 

Physical Demands:  The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. 

 

While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to walk, stand, and lift.  Occasionally, the employee must crouch or kneel.  The employee must be able to exert or lift up to 25 pounds.

 

Work Environment:  The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. 

The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ate. 

 

Professional Requirements:  Must serve as a role model to students.  Desirable personal characteristics are required. Appropriate dress and grooming consistent with established standards required.  Must be at work on time, adhere to attendance standards and conduct activities safely.

 

Confidential Data Exposure:   The nature of this position entails exposure to confidential data.  Confidentiality must be held regarding financial and personal information.
